Brief reference. The window the user is working in this moment time is called active. The active window is placed in the foreground on top of other windows. Any command refers to the active window, which is running in the foreground.

5. Examine the main elements of the window. Locate the following window elements on the screen:

Borders - frames that bound the window on four sides. By grabbing and dragging the border with the mouse, you can resize the window;

The title bar below the top border of the window. By grabbing the window title with the mouse, you can move the window;

The button for calling the system menu is located on the left in the title bar (the appearance of the button usually corresponds to the contents of the window). By clicking on it with the mouse, you can open a list of window management commands;


Rice. 2.3. Windows 2000 Getting Started window
window control buttons Minimize, Restore, Close(on the right in the title bar);

The menu bar below the title. The menu provides access to basic set commands;

Toolbar (buttons for basic operations). The toolbar is an optional window element that contains icons and buttons for quick access to the most commonly used commands. You can add a toolbar from the menu View team Toolbar;

Scrollbars that allow vertical and horizontal movement when the window borders do not allow you to see all the contents of the window.

Brief reference. When working with multiple windows, the easiest way to switch to another window is to click on the visible part of the window. If the windows are maximized to full screen, then the transition is carried out in one of the following ways: by clicking on the button with the name of the window in the taskbar or by pressing the and keys (a window with icons of running programs will open in the middle of the screen; without releasing the key, press the key).

6. Make a window My computer active and learn the process of minimizing/maximizing windows. Expand the window to full screen with the button Expand- the window will increase in size and occupy the entire desktop. At the same time, the button Expand turn into a button Reestablish with two overlapping squares. By clicking on the button Reestablish, we return the window to its previous form.

Brief reference. How to resize a window?

To change the window width, move the mouse pointer to the vertical side of the window. The pointer changes to a horizontal double-edged arrow. Drag the edge of the window sideways horizontally and the window shrinks.

To change the height of a window, move the mouse pointer over the top or bottom sides of the window, and the cursor will change into a vertical double-edged arrow. Drag the edge of the window and the window will resize in height.

To simultaneously change the height and width of the window, move the cursor to the corner of the window - the mouse pointer will turn into a diagonal double-edged arrow. By dragging the window frame diagonally, you will reduce the size of the window.

Window working field Conductor divided into vertical regions. The left side of the window displays the folder hierarchy of the computer (directory tree) - a complete "tree" of everything that is on the computer. You can view the entire "tree" from the roots to the top using the scroll bar (bar) located on the right side of the window.

Folders are attached to the central trunk in the form of "branches". If the folder has subfolders, then the node to which the "branch" is attached has a "+" sign. If you click on it with the mouse, the folder will expand into a new branch, and the “+” sign will change to a “-” sign. If you now click on "-", then the branch will collapse back into a folder.

When a folder is open in the left pane and a folder is always open, its contents will be shown in the right pane.

So, the left part of the window is designed for quick browsing of folders. If the folder is closed, and other folders are nested in it, there is a “+” sign next to it; if it is opened and the elements included in it are indicated, then there is a “-” sign next to it.
